Glenda Doering, 69, of North Augusta, SC, passed away peacefully at home on Saturday, May 22, 2021. She was born on February 9, 1952 in Cassville, Missouri to the late Walter Edison Henry and Georgia Lorene Burnett Henry and was married to Terry Lee Doering, who she loved and supported for 49 years.
Glenda enjoyed swimming, researching genealogy, traveling, experiencing new places and just loving the outdoors. Glenda loved sports and enjoyed playing college volleyball, basketball and softball. She passionately loved her children and grandchildren and prayed for them daily. God’s word and Jesus was everything to her, and she supported a ministry which helped women and orphans.
